Catalina is over rated. It's fun for the day, but you'll be bored out of your mind if you plan on staying there for the weekend.

Ventura beach is a nice, low-key, relatively inexpensive place to hang out for the weekend, and then a little North of there like others mentioned is Santa Barbara, which is a little more pricey, but has wineries and some fun, romantic things like that to do. Just North of San Luis Obispo is a Morro Bay, and the Inn at Morro Bay is a pimp place to spend a romantic weekend and lounge out. All of these destinations can be nice PCH drives btw.

does the cold bother you?

if not, take a nice drive from SF to LA on Hwy 1 stopping along the beach in Monterey, Pismo Beach or Santa Barbara. drive along HWY 1 from SF to Santa Barbara will take 10+ hours, but it's a beautiful drive and won't break the bank.

the further north you go in Cali, the colder the coast line. cold means ~50-60F at night with a good breeze.

If you want to stay in the Santa Barbara area for cheap, and don't mind a 15 minute drive, stay in Carpinteria at one of the beach hotels. In the off season (aka right now), they can be rather cheap and have the amenities you want. You also then get access to Santa Barbara, Santa Ynez wineries, and heck, if you want I can see if I can get you guys a deal at my friend's restaurant
